Girl Meets World debuted on the Disney Channel on June 27, 2014 and it has aired a total of 16 episodes as of December 18, 2014 and Girl Meets World's episode order for the first season is 21 and the Girl Meets World cast and crew are currently working on producing the second season of the series.

Yes, Shawn Hunter will be appearing in multiple episodes of Girl Meets World, in the first season he returns in the Christmas episode that is titled "Girl Meets Home for the Holdays" which aired on December 5, 2014 and it also featured the return of Cory's Mom; Amy Matthews and his Dad; Alan Matthews as well as his younger brother; Joshua Matthews.
